Sarita bought 12 bananas at the farmer’s market. Each banana cost $0.35 cents. She paid with a $10 bill. How much change did she get?

Respuesta :

schoolaccount66 schoolaccount66
  • 05-06-2021

Answer:

her change is $5.80

Step-by-step explanation:

12 x 0.35 = 4.2

10 - 4.2 = 5.8
